  5. Reed McLay's Avatar
    That is very unusual, but rolling it back is simple.

    Download and install the earlier v4.2.2.180 from T-Mobile. You should see that listed below the current v4.5xx OS package.

    Use Windows Control Panel / Programs / Uninstall to remove the v4.5xx package.

    Run BlackBerry Desktop Manager / Applications Loader. You will be prompted to roll back.
